| Title: | Ice cliffs at the seaward margin of the Courtauld Glacier, East Greenland |
| Description: | The ice cliffs at the seaward margin of the heavily-crevassed Courtauld Glacier, East Greenland, rise about 40 m above the sea-surface. The dark debris bands, or medial moraines, on the ice surface are produced from rockfall onto the glacier as ice flows past the surrounding mountains. |
